    Batista's Hole in the Wall sucks.

    It isn't "off strip", but is actually right across the street from Bally's in a highly touristy area (Flamingo, slightly east of the LV Blvd.)

    It masquerades as an old-style, family-owned Italian restaurant which isn't full of strip gimmickry and inflated prices.

    Except that's exactly what it is.

    It's a low-quality, overpriced restaurant aimed exclusively at tourists. They even serve really terrible wine there which is "included" in the price (I honestly should have just walked out when I heard that policy.)

    Here are some Italian restaurants off-strip which I've either been to or have heard had good reputations:

    Gaetano's (Henderson): http://www.usmenuguide.com/gaetanos.html ... Not close to strip but good reputation

    Capo's Speakeasy (Sahara, east of strip): http://www.caposrestaurant.com/ ... Modeled after a prohibition-era speakeasy, they actually have a locked front door where they "check you out" before letting you in. Kind of a fun atmosphere to take a date, and not too over-the-top or stupid. Food is decent.

    Luna Rossa (Henderson): http://lunarossalakelv.com/ ... Not close to strip, but just good-quality, tasty Italian food. I ate in their downtown LV location a few times until they closed it. The only problem with the downtown LV location was a poorly designed building that was freezing in the winter (never went during the hot months), which probably contributed to its failure. This is a different building in a different location, but with the same ownership and menu.
